Leaving Intermediate calibration

Hold down the

depth

and

speed

keys for 2 seconds, to save your settings,

exit Intermediate calibration and resume normal operation.

4.4 Dealer calibration

The Dealer calibration procedures enable the following parameters to be
set:

User calibration on/off.

Speed response.

Depth response.

Boat show mode on/off.

Dealer calibration also gives access to the Factory defaults screen. This
enables you to re-apply the factory settings if you want to reset the
instrument to a known operating condition.

To commence Dealer calibration, hold down the

depth

and

speed

keys

together for approximately 12 seconds, to select the Dealer calibration
entry page (see Dealer calibration diagram). Then press the

trip

and

reset

keys together, to enter the calibration screen sequence.

Use the depth key to move from screen to screen and the trip or the rest
key to set the required values at each screen.

User calibration on/off

Press either the

trip

or

reset

key to toggle the User calibration on or off as

required. With off selected, User calibration and Intermediate calibration
are both disabled.

Response settings

The response values for both SPEED and DEPTH determine the frequency
at which information is updated. A low number provides a smooth
response and a high number a much livelier update.

Use the

trip

(decrement) and

reset

(increment) keys to set the required

value. Response values are from 1 to 15.
